RTÉ star Maia Dunphy and hubby Johnny Vegas have tweeted this funny baby scan photo to announce they are expecting their first child.

The What Women Want presenter posted a picture of her scan on Twitter – photoshopping in a pint of Guinness.

The couple - who have been married three and a half years - revealed last year that they had never lived together due to their clashing work commitments in both England and Ireland.

At the time Maia admitted that the couple were planning to wait until they moved in together to begin a family, and today's announcement marks the three months anniversary of her moving to the UK from Dublin.

“The longest time we spent together which was two weeks. Now suddenly we’re living together in London and it’s a lovely house, a small house, it’s cosy,” she has said.

Comedian Johnny, 40, already has an 11-year-old son Michael, with his ex-wife.
